After last update, in 9.3 stable, shell no longer works.

On clicking "Shell", a narrow vertical window appears, showing the text "Loading". This hangs there for like 5 seconds, and then disappears. Nothing appears in the bottom three-line window.

This has been tried in Firefox on Solaris, and latest Firefox and system default web browser under windows 10.

I have a workaround, enabling sshd and configuring a user using jexec in the top environment .

like so:
jexec <jailname> sh
